How to Request PoF and PoD Letters. Both a proof of funds letter and a proof of deposit letter can be requested from your bank. The bank where you have your main checking or savings account will be the best option as they can easily verify the cash you have available.

How do I get proof of deposit?

Your bank will verify the source of your deposit by looking at a bank statement. It will make sure that you have enough funds in your account to make your down payment. That verification as a form is known as the PoD. It can actually be good for you as well, especially if you're already a homeowner.

How to request proof of funds from a bank?

To request a POF letter, make a written request, head down to your local bank branch or call customer service. Most financial institutions can generate the letter demonstrating your funds across all accounts in 1 day.

What is proof of bank deposit?

In commercial banking, proof of deposit is the financial institution's verification that funds have been deposited into an account and where these deposits came from. To do so, the institution will compare the amount written on the check to the amount on the deposit slip.

What qualifies as proof of funds?

Proof of funds usually comes in the form of a bank security or custody statement. These can be procured from your bank or the financial institution that holds your money. Bank statements are the most common document to use as POF and can typically be found online or at a bank branch.

What is a proof of deposit letter?

The proof of deposit letter verifies that the requisite funds for a large purchase or down payment have been deposited into an account and where those funds come from. As with proof of funds, this document is commonly required when someone is applying for a mortgage to buy a house.

How do I get a deposit letter from my bank?

In-person: The quickest way to obtain a bank letter is to request one in-person. By doing so, you'll be able to ensure that everything you need is on the letter & be able to make changes if necessary. By phone: Another convenient way to obtain a bank letter is to call your bank's support line.

What is a certificate of bank deposit?

A certificate of deposit, or CD, is a type of savings account offered by banks and credit unions. You generally agree to keep your money in the CD without taking a withdrawal for a specified length of time. Withdrawing money early means paying a penalty fee to the bank.

How do I get a bank deposit statement?

If you are an Online Banking customer, you can sign into Online Banking, and select Statements & Documents under the Accounts tab, then go to the Request statements tab and select Order a paper statement copy. Paper statements will be mailed 7 to 10 business days after you submit your request.

What is considered a certificate of deposit?

A certificate of deposit (CD) is a savings account that holds a fixed amount of money for a fixed period of time, such as six months, one year, or five years, and in exchange, the issuing bank pays interest. When you cash in or redeem your CD, you receive the money you originally invested plus any interest.

How much does a $1000 CD make in a year?

A $1,000 CD deposit makes $50 of interest in a year if the account pays 5% APY. The CD's total balance would be $1,050 at maturity.

What is sufficient for proof of funds?

Cash or readily accessible money can be used for a proof of funds letter. This can be money you are keeping in a checking or savings account although a money market account may also qualify. The key is that the money needs to be easy to access when you need it.

How do you demonstrate proof of funds?

Proof of funds can be shown with:
  1. An agreement in principle/mortgage in principle.
  2. Bank statements of your deposit amount (for mortgage buyers)
  3. Bank statements of your cash amount (for cash buyers)
  4. Evidence of you selling a property (if using the funds to buy the new property)
  5. Evidence if the money has been gifted.

How long does it take to get proof of funds?

If the money is in one account, your bank may be able to verify funds and provide you a proof of funds letter within a day. If you have to transfer funds from another account, it may take longer.
